Toegang tot een specifiek benoemd bereik in Excel

Invoering

In de snelle wereld van vandaag is data alles. Bedrijven floreren op inzichten die uit data worden afgeleid, en het efficiënt manipuleren van die data is essentieel. Excel is al lang een go-to-applicatie voor iedereen die met cijfers moet werken, maar als het gaat om het automatiseren van taken en het programmatisch beheren van die data, wenden we ons vaak tot bibliotheken die ons leven vereenvoudigen. Een van die krachtige bibliotheken is Aspose.Cells voor .NET. Of u nu een softwareontwikkelaar bent die Excel-processen wil automatiseren of een bedrijfsanalist die specifieke gegevensbereiken uit uw spreadsheets wil halen, deze tutorial begeleidt u bij het openen van specifieke benoemde bereiken in Excel met behulp van Aspose.Cells voor .NET. Laten we erin duiken!

Vereisten

Voordat we beginnen, moet u ervoor zorgen dat u aan de volgende vereisten voldoet:

  1. Visual Studio: Zorg ervoor dat Visual Studio op uw machine is geïnstalleerd. U kunt het downloaden vanhier.
  2. .NET Framework: Zorg ervoor dat u het juiste .NET Framework hebt geïnstalleerd. Aspose.Cells ondersteunt meerdere versies, dus controleer de documentatie op compatibiliteit.
  3. Aspose.Cells-bibliotheek: U kunt de Aspose.Cells-bibliotheek downloaden van dewebsiteU kunt er ook voor kiezen om NuGet Package Manager in Visual Studio te gebruiken om het te installeren.
  4. Basiskennis van C#: Kennis van C#-programmering en de basisprincipes van Excel zijn nuttig. Nu we de benodigdheden paraat hebben, kunnen we verder!

Pakketten importeren

Om aan de slag te gaan met Aspose.Cells voor .NET, moet u de benodigde pakketten importeren. Dit kunt u doen door de juiste naamruimten in uw C#-bestand op te nemen. Dit doet u als volgt:

using System.IO;
using System;
using Aspose.Cells;

Met deze regel kunt u werken met alle klassen en methoden in de Aspose.Cells-bibliotheek.

Stap 1: Initialiseer de werkmap

Eerst moet u een exemplaar van de makenWorkbook klasse en laad uw Excel-bestand.

string sourceDir = "Your Document Directory"; //het pad voorzien
Workbook workbook = new Workbook(sourceDir + "sampleAccessSpecificNamedRange.xlsx");

Hier, vervang"Your Document Directory" met het daadwerkelijke pad waar uw bestand is opgeslagen.

Stap 2: Toegang tot het benoemde bereik

Om het opgegeven benoemde bereik te verkrijgen, gebruikt u deGetRangeByName methode. Hiermee wordt het bereik opgehaald dat is gekoppeld aan de naam die u eerder hebt toegewezen.

Range range = workbook.Worksheets.GetRangeByName("MyRangeTwo");

Stap 3: Controleer of het bereik bestaat

Het is essentieel om te controleren of het bereik succesvol is opgehaald om fouten met betrekking tot null-referenties te voorkomen.

if (range != null)
	Console.WriteLine("Named Range: " + range.RefersTo);
else
	Console.WriteLine("Named Range not found.");

Conclusie

Gefeliciteerd! U hebt succesvol toegang gekregen tot een specifiek benoemd bereik in Excel met Aspose.Cells voor .NET. Deze krachtige bibliotheek haalt de rompslomp uit Excel-manipulaties en geeft u de flexibiliteit om taken efficiënt te automatiseren. Of u nu een ontwikkelaar of een data-analist bent, door de kracht van Aspose.Cells te benutten, bespaart u tijd en verbetert u uw productiviteit.

Veelgestelde vragen

Wat is Aspose.Cells voor .NET?

Aspose.Cells voor .NET is een krachtige bibliotheek waarmee ontwikkelaars programmatisch Excel-bestanden kunnen maken, bewerken en converteren zonder dat ze Microsoft Excel nodig hebben.

Hoe kan ik Aspose.Cells gratis uitproberen?

kunt een gratis proefversie van Aspose.Cells downloaden van de websitehier.

Kan ik toegang krijgen tot meerdere benoemde bereiken?

Ja, u kunt toegang krijgen tot meerdere benoemde bereiken doorGetRangeByName meerdere keren, telkens met een andere bereiknaam.

Is Aspose.Cells compatibel met alle versies van Excel?

Ja, Aspose.Cells ondersteunt verschillende formaten, waaronder .xls, .xlsx en meer.

Waar kan ik ondersteuning krijgen voor Aspose.Cells?

Ondersteuning voor Aspose.Cells vindt u in deAspose-forum.